Output 65ca2eb2e38480612cca5e76c1ffec285a1b6ac589aa2aa0beab4cf76506a1d7:24

value
17134925
script pubkey
OP_0 OP_PUSHBYTES_20 5551cc37f5e175cb07070d41ed761e89cf048b23
address
bc1q24gucdl4u96ukpc8p4q76as7388sfzerldytdp
transaction
65ca2eb2e38480612cca5e76c1ffec285a1b6ac589aa2aa0beab4cf76506a1d7
spent
false